What Is Customer Persona Development?
Customer persona development is the process of creating detailed, research-backed profiles that represent key segments of your user base. These profiles combine demographic data, behavioral trends, motivations, challenges, and goals—providing a comprehensive understanding of how different users engage with your SaaS product.

How to Implement Each Customer Persona Development Strategy
1. Leverage Onboarding Surveys to Capture User Intent and Needs
Onboarding surveys are a vital first step to understand who your users are and what they expect from your product. Embedding short, targeted surveys during or immediately after signup helps gather critical data such as user goals, company size, role, and use cases. Platforms like Zigpoll, Typeform, or SurveyMonkey offer seamless integration of quick polls without disrupting the user experience.
Action Steps:
- Embed 3-5 question surveys within onboarding emails or product tours
- Ask about user role, primary pain points, and desired outcomes
- Automatically tag and segment users based on responses for personalized follow-up
Business Outcome: Early segmentation enables tailored onboarding flows, improving activation rates and reducing time-to-value.
2. Analyze Behavioral Data to Segment by Feature Usage Patterns
Behavioral analytics reveal how users interact with your product, highlighting who quickly finds value and who may need additional support. Segmenting users based on feature adoption during their initial weeks identifies “activated” versus “non-activated” cohorts.
Action Steps:
- Utilize product analytics platforms like Mixpanel, Amplitude, or Heap to track sessions and feature use
- Define activation criteria tied to core features indicating value realization
- Create user groups based on feature usage patterns for targeted messaging and onboarding
Business Outcome: Behavioral segmentation provides actionable insights to boost engagement and reduce churn.
3. Conduct Customer Interviews to Uncover Motivations and Pain Points
Quantitative data is powerful, but qualitative interviews add depth by revealing the “why” behind user behaviors. Interviewing users from various segments uncovers workflows, challenges, and motivations that numbers alone cannot capture.
Action Steps:
- Select interviewees from onboarding survey segments or behavioral cohorts
- Prepare open-ended questions about daily tasks, frustrations, and goals
- Record and analyze interviews to identify recurring themes and unique insights
Business Outcome: Richer persona profiles inform product improvements and marketing messaging.
4. Map Customer Journeys to Identify Activation and Churn Triggers
Visualizing the entire user experience—from signup through onboarding, feature adoption, and renewal—helps pinpoint drop-off points and moments of delight. This insight is critical to designing interventions that reduce friction.
Action Steps:
- Use funnel analysis tools like Amplitude or Heap to track user flows
- Identify where churn occurs and correlate with persona segments
- Develop persona-specific onboarding content and in-app prompts to smooth the journey
Business Outcome: Targeted interventions improve retention and activation by addressing specific pain points.

7. Segment by Firmographic Data for B2B SaaS Targeting
For SaaS products serving businesses, firmographic attributes such as company size, industry, and revenue provide a powerful segmentation dimension. Combining this with behavioral and satisfaction data creates comprehensive personas.
Action Steps:
- Collect firmographic data during signup or enrich CRM data using Clearbit or ZoomInfo
- Integrate firmographics with other persona data for nuanced segmentation
- Customize marketing campaigns and onboarding flows based on company profiles
Business Outcome: More effective B2B targeting and personalized experiences that drive conversion and upsell.
8. Apply Predictive Analytics to Forecast Persona Value and Churn Risk
Machine learning models can forecast which personas will deliver high lifetime value or are at risk of churning. Predictive analytics enables proactive engagement tailored to risk profiles.
Action Steps:
- Input historical user data into tools like Salesforce Einstein or DataRobot
- Identify behavioral patterns and early warning signs linked to churn or high value
- Adjust engagement and retention strategies based on predictive risk scores
Business Outcome: Reduced churn and optimized resource allocation through data-driven forecasting.
9. Continuously Validate and Update Personas Based on New Data
Personas are not static—they evolve as markets and products change. Regularly revisiting your data ensures personas remain accurate and actionable.
Action Steps:
- Conduct quarterly reviews of persona profiles and segmentation criteria
- Incorporate new onboarding survey responses, behavioral analytics, and satisfaction scores (tools like Zigpoll work well here)
- Refine or retire outdated assumptions to keep personas relevant
Business Outcome: Dynamic personas that reflect current realities, enabling ongoing targeted marketing and product development.
